Pair of Free Span Armchairs FS 123, France, 1954
By Free Span
Located in Catonvielle, FR
Superb pair of FS 123 armchairs from the French brand Free-Span published in 1954. The structure in blond beech has a curved design, the speckled fabric of white and gray is padded with kapok. The exceptional comfort of these seats is provided by springs combined with metal plates arranged in stars, signature of the Free-Span brand and adopted by designers such as Pierre Guariche, Marcel Gascoin or Jacques Adnet. Very beautiful state. Documentation: La Maison Française...

Rare pair of A1 lounge chairs by Jean-Claude Duboys, Attitude edition, France, 1980. Amazing comfort, these seats are made of solid maple blades, they fold and are part of a set of furniture created in the years 80 by Jean-Claude Duboys, Designer Interior Designer, (1938-1999). A copy is part of the collection of the Museum of Decorative Arts (Paris). New state of origin. (More edited today) Trade shows: Scandinavian Fumiture Fair, Copenhagen 1981. International Furniture Fair, Cologne 1982. International Furniture Fair, Milan, 1982. Salon SAD, society of the decorating artists, Paris 1983...
